Eli Lilly and Nvidia are teaming up to build a cutting-edge supercomputer that could revolutionize drug discovery, aiming to drastically cut research time and costs in an industry notorious for its slow pace and high expenses.
Eli Lilly, a leading pharmaceutical company, has partnered with Nvidia, the renowned artificial-intelligence chip designer, to build what both companies claim will be the most powerful supercomputer in the pharmaceutical industry. This collaboration aims to significantly enhance drug discovery processes and accelerate research timelines.
The partnership between Eli Lilly and Nvidia represents a strategic move towards leveraging advanced AI technologies to address the lengthy and costly process of drug development. According to the Pharmaceutical Research and Manufacturers of America (PhRMA), bringing a new drug to market can take up to 12 years and cost over $2 billion. By harnessing the power of AI, Eli Lilly hopes to reduce these timelines and costs, ultimately leading to faster delivery of life-saving treatments.
